well after a 3 month hiatus (lots of hours at work) im back into working on the saiga, and i think the first mod i want to do is one of the galil style front handguards if thats possible. i see they sell em in tapco for 39.99 for the ak and 59.99 for the saiga. this may be a stupid question but which one do i want? im going to assume when it says one is for the saiga it means the 7.62 or .308, not the shotgun. either way, which one do i go with and how much if any am i going to have to modify it?

I believe Tapco's Saiga version of the handguard fits the Saigas X39 and 223. The 410 one would require modification if it would work at all.

 

I haven't yet done a short wooden handguard for the Saiga 410, but there's only one detail I would have to check before promising I could. If you're interested in wood give me a holler.

 

You may have to check on this, but Dinzag's handguard retainers may also be a solution, which would use the $39.99 AK pattern Galil handguard.

This looks like and old topic but i didn't want to start a new thread about it. MY tapco saiga galil handguard on my .410 was a little hard to use the sights with that cover on and was horrible looking with it off just too much empty space along the sides of the gas tube. my solution was cut along the level of the top of the retainer then use my cut pieces to fill fill the inside by plastic welding the 2 together then sanding smooth. Nothing to special but might ive someone else some ideas if they want to change their handguard a little. :rolleyes:
